What are the Benefits of Using ChatGPT? As an AI-powered language model, ChatGPT offers several benefits to users, including: • Speed and Efficiency: Processing and generating text much faster than a human, allowing for quick and efficient responses to inquiries or requests. • Consistency and Accuracy: ChatGPT is designed to provide consistent and accurate responses, regardless of the complexity of the question or the volume of requests. • Availability: Available 24/7, making it possible to provide support or assistance at any time, even outside of normal busi ness hours. • Customization: Can be fine-tuned to specific tasks or domains, allowing users to tailor its capabilities to their specific needs and requirements. • Cost-effectiveness: Compared to hiring human agents to provide support or assistance, using an AI-powered language model like ChatGPT can be a cost-effective solution, especially for high-volume or repetitive tasks. In addition, as an AI-powered language model, ChatGPT has the potential to continually improve and evolve as it processes more data and learns from its interactions with users. What Shouldn’t ChatGPT be Used for? ChatGPT should not be used for: • Sensitive or Confidential Information: Since the model is trained on a diverse range of text and data, it is not suitable for handling sensitive or confidential information. • Making Critical Decisions: ChatGPT is a language model, not a decision-making tool, and should not be used to make critical decisions with real-world consequences. • Tasks that Require Human-level Understanding and Empathy: While ChatGPT can generate text that appears to be written by a human, it lacks the empathy, emotional intel ligence, and cultural understanding of a real person. • Safety-critical Applications: ChatGPT is not designed for use in safety-critical applications, such as autonomous vehicles or medical devices, where incorrect responses could have serious consequences. In general, ChatGPT is a powerful tool for generating and processing text, but it is important to use it responsibly and understand its limi tations and capabilities. How is ChatGPT Different Than a Search Engine, Such as Google? ChatGPT and search engines like Google serve different purposes and use different techniques to answer queries. A search engine like Google is designed to help users find informa tion on the web by indexing billions of web pages and ranking them based on relevance to a user's query. When you search for something on Google, the search engine returns a list of links to web pages that it considers to be the most relevant to your query. ChatGPT, on the other hand, is a language model that can generate text based on a prompt. Instead of returning a list of links, ChatGPT generates a response directly, which can include text, numbers, or other types of information. The primary difference between ChatGPT and a search engine is that ChatGPT is designed to generate text based on a prompt, while search engines are designed to search the web and find relevant infor mation.
